More About "crossword clue bellows"

"Bellows" is a fascinating word in the world of crosswords because it functions as both a verb and a noun, each with distinct meanings that can be clued in various ways. As a verb, it typically refers to making a loud, deep, resonant sound, often associated with anger, pain, or the natural sounds of large animals like bulls or lions. This sense often leads to answers like ROARS or SHOUTS, capturing the vocal aspect of the word.

As a noun, "bellows" refers to a device for delivering a powerful blast of air, primarily used for stoking fires in furnaces or forges. This mechanical function can lead to answers like FAN or even more descriptive terms related to air movement. The dual nature of the word requires solvers to pay close attention to the context of the clue, including any descriptors or the number of letters, to determine which meaning is intended.

Understanding these different facets of "bellows" is crucial for solving. Crossword setters love to exploit words with multiple meanings or those that can act as different parts of speech, making "bellows" a classic example of such a versatile clue word.
